About Lot Eye Drops 5 ml

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ml is used to treat post-operative inflammation and pain following ocular surgery. Pain is an unpleasant sensation and emotional experience that is associated with tissue damage. Inflammation is the immune system's natural response to injury or infection. Lot Eye Drops 5 ml is prescribed to treat redness and swelling (inflammation) of the eye.

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ml contains Loteprednol etabonate. It is a corticosteroid that works by blocking prostaglandins (a chemical messenger) in the brain that cause inflammation and swelling. Thereby, Lot Eye Drops 5 ml helps treat inflammation and pain. 

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ml is for ophthalmic use only. You are advised to use Lot Eye Drops 5 ml for as long as your doctor has prescribed it. In some cases, Lot Eye Drops 5 ml may cause watery eyes, irritation, itching, and a sensation of a foreign body in the eye. Most of these side effects of Lot Eye Drops 5 ml are temporary, do not require medical attention, and gradually resolve over time. However, if the side effects are persistent, reach out to your doctor.

Do not take Lot Eye Drops 5 ml if you are allergic to corticosteroids or any ingredient of Lot Eye Drops 5 ml. Also, do not use more than the prescribed dose of Lot Eye Drops 5 ml, as it may cause glaucoma, fungal infections, and cataracts. Do not take any other eye medication with Lot Eye Drops 5 ml, without consulting your doctor. If you have/had glaucoma (increased eye pressure), herpes simplex infection, any other eye problem, or are pregnant or breastfeeding, do not take Lot Eye Drops 5 ml unless prescribed by your doctor.

Directions for Use

  • Lot Eye Drops 5 ml is typically used 1-2 times a day, or as prescribed by your healthcare provider, based on the severity of the condition.
  • Tilt your head back, gently pull down your lower eyelid to create a small pocket, and drop the prescribed number of drops into the affected eye. Close your eye and gently press the corner of your eye near the nose for 1-2 minutes to prevent the drops from draining out.
  • Avoid touching the dropper to any surface, including your eyes, to prevent contamination.
  • Before using eye drops, wash your hands thoroughly.
  • It is for ophthalmic use only.

Drug Warnings

Inform your doctor if you are allergic to corticosteroids or any of the ingredients of Lot Eye Drops 5 ml. Do not take more than the prescribed dose of Lot Eye Drops 5 ml as it may cause glaucoma, vision problems, fungal infection or cataract. If you have or ever had glaucoma (increased eye pressure), herpes simplex infection, any other eye problem, or are pregnant, do not take Lot Eye Drops 5 ml unless prescribed by your doctor. Avoid using Lot Eye Drops 5 ml if you are breastfeeding. Lot Eye Drops 5 ml may cause temporary blurred vision, so drive only if your vision is clear.

FAQs

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ml is used to treat post-operative inflammation and pain following ocular surgery.

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ml works by blocking prostaglandins (a chemical messenger) in the brain, which causes inflammation and swelling. As a result, Lot Eye Drops 5 ml reduces inflammation and pain.

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ml should be taken in the dose and duration as advised by the doctor. If you take more than the recommended dose, it may cause unwanted side effects, such as increased eye pressure, fungal infection, optic nerve damage, vision problems, or cataracts. If you think your symptoms are not improving, please consult your doctor.

Do not stop taking Lot Eye Drops 5 ml without talking to your doctor. Continue using Lot Eye Drops 5 ml for as long as it has been advised by the doctor to treat your condition effectively. If you experience any difficulty while using Lot Eye Drops 5 ml, consult your doctor.

Avoid wearing contact lenses while using Lot Eye Drops 5 ml. If you are wearing contact lenses, remove them and wait 15 minutes after applying the drops. However, wearing contact lenses is not recommended post-cataract surgery. Your doctor may advise you to wear glasses as they help the eyes recover from the operative procedure.

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ml should be used with other eye medications only if prescribed by the doctor. If you are using any other eye medications, inform your doctor as anti-glaucoma agents may increase the effects of Lot Eye Drops 5 ml.

The common side effects of Lot Eye Drops 5 ml include watery eyes, irritation, itching, and a foreign body sensation in the eye. Most of these side effects are temporary; however, if they persist, please consult your doctor.

Before using Lot Eye Drops 5 ml, make sure you are not allergic to any of its components or corticosteroids. Inform your doctor if you have or ever had glaucoma (increased eye pressure), herpes simplex infection, or any other eye problem. Also, let your doctor know if you are pregnant and breastfeeding, wearing contact lenses, or taking other medications. Always follow the prescribed dosage and avoid contact with the dropper tip to prevent contamination.

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ml should only be used during pregnancy if prescribed by your doctor. Since information on its safety during pregnancy may be limited, your doctor will prescribe it only if the benefits outweigh the risks.

Yes, Lot Eye Drops 5 ml is effective when used at the dose and duration recommended by your doctor. If you stop using Lot Eye Drops 5 ml too early, the symptoms may return or worsen.

The use of Lot Eye Drops 5 ml should be avoided in individuals who are allergic to any of its components. It is also not recommended for use in most viral infections of the cornea and conjunctiva, such as herpes simplex infection, as well as in mycobacterial and fungal infections of the eye. If you have any concerns about using Lot Eye Drops 5 ml, please consult your doctor.

Lot Eye Drops 5 ml should be stored at room temperature, away from direct sunlight. Keep it out of reach of children.
